Jakarta (Antara) - President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ono said 2013 and 2014 are decisive years with regard to achieving a success in the country's economic development. "The current 2013 and the next 2014 in view of economic development efforts are important and defining," he said at the opening of a cabinet meeting here on Thursday. Firstly, he said, there would be a need to maintain the economy in the period due to external challenges which are not easy to deal with. He said the world's economic conditions would still remain uncertain and recession would still continue. "This situation will give real pressure especially to economic growth," he said. He said Indonesia meanwhile would at the same time also prepare itself for the general elections in 2014 making the domestic political climate to be hotter. "On the one hand we must maintain our economy and on the other we must manage domestic political conditions well as they are also related to economic development efforts," he said. In view of that he said he has called for careful and correct planning of government programs and setting of indicators. "If all is correct any dynamic that may happen will certainly be manageable while we can still focus on achieving the targets set for 2013 and 2014," he said. President Yudhoyono said in the next two years all targets set in the Mid-term National Development Plan for 2009-2014 must be achieved.
